US Treasury Cybersecurity Breach Highlights Growing Supply Chain Security Threats for 2025

A recent cybersecurity breach at the US Department of the Treasury, attributed to a Chinese state-backed actor, has raised serious concerns about supply chain security risks. Cybercriminals Continue to Focus on Exploiting Vulnerabilities in the Supply Chain to Gain Backdoor Access to Organizations Systems and Critical Data

Cybercriminals and hackers have increasingly exploited vulnerabilities in industry standard IT and security tools, leading to major security incidents. Incidents across multiple market segments highlight how quickly liabilities in widely used management tools can become targets for both state-sponsored groups and ransomware operators, underscoring the importance of safeguarding against supply chain cyberattacks. Healthcare Organizations and Vendor Cyberattacks: A Guide to Preparation and Response

The number of cyberattacks is on the rise, and healthcare providers are a prime target. These attacks often come through third-party vendors, increasing the risk for healthcare organizations.
